Default XK8 No start after battery disconnect

2002 XK8 had dead battery. Took battery out and had it recharged and tested. Battery now fine. Re-Installed battery but engine will not crank. Dash lights on but no crank. Is there some kind of reset, since the battery was out of the car for a few days?

Are you stepping on the brake before attempting to move the shifter ? With the shifter in P you should be able to hear a solenoid -click- when you depress the brake pedal with the engine running, or at least with the ignition switch in the last position before the starter is engaged ( position 3 ??).


Z

PS do you have the owners manual set ? There is info in the manual about how to manually disengage the shifter lock. First the plastic blocking plug needs to be removed. You will need a Torx bit to do that, although a large blade screw driver might work.

The TIBBE key is what is supposed to be used once the TORX plug has been removed.

Insert key shaft and move selector to N.

Remove key and insert into ignition lock barrel.

START ENGINE.
